Chemical Identifiers
CAS5153-68-4
IUPAC Name1-methyl-4-(2-nitroethenyl)benzene
Molecular FormulaC9H9NO2
InChI KeyJSPNBERPFLONRX-UHFFFAOYSA-N
SMILESCC1=CC=C(C=C[N+]([O-])=O)C=C1

SpecificationsSpecification SheetSpecification Sheet
Appearance (Color)Pale yellow to yellow
FormCrystals or powder or crystalline powder or fused solid
Assay (GC)≥97.5%
Melting Point (clear melt)100.0-106.0?C
trans-4-Methyl-β-nitrostyrene may be used as a reagent in the synthesis of N-benzylpyrrolomorphinans. It is also used as an organic intermediate for pharmaceutical.

Applications
trans-4-Methyl-β-nitrostyrene may be used as a reagent in the synthesis of N-benzylpyrrolomorphinans. It is also used as an organic intermediate for pharmaceutical.

Solubility
Sparingly Soluble in water (0.070 g/L) (25°C).

Notes
Store in cool place. Keep container tightly closed in a dry and well-ventilated place. Recommended storage temperature: 2 - 8°C. Stable under recommended storage conditions. Keep away from strong oxidizing agents.
